Latest Patents

Among his latest patents, Pfaffli has developed N,N-diethyl-N'-[(8.alpha.)-1-ethyl-6-methyl-ergolin-8-yl]-sulfamide. This invention provides a compound that is useful for inhibiting prolactin secretion and serves as an anti-Parkinson and anti-depressant agent. Additionally, he has worked on organic compounds, specifically decahydro or octahydro-4-phenyl-cis-isoquinoline derivatives, which are recognized for their potential as analgesics, anti-depressants, tranquilizers, and sleep inducers.
